Regional Initiatives for the Arab States - BDT Year in Review 2024

Regional Initiatives for the Arab States

ARB1: Sustainable digital economy through digital transformation

National Emergency Telecommunications Plans (NETP) were successfully developed for Mauritania and Libya.

Under Connect2Recover, efforts were made to advance projects in Comoros, Djibouti, and Somalia, with a focus on strengthening their emergency telecommunications capabilities.

In collaboration with United Nations Economic and Social Commission for Western Asia (ESCWA), the Ministry of Digital Economy and Entrepreneurship of Jordan was assisted in assessing the digital ecosystem with a focus on creating new jobs.

In Tunisia, the Digital for Reforms project, funded by GiZ, helped build capacities of over 200 public civil servants to boost digital transformation.

In Egypt, the first Global Digital Public Infrastructure Summit, co-organized with United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) and CoDevelop, bought together over 500 participants representing stakeholders from governments, private sector, international and regional organizations and academia to discuss the future of Digital Public Infrastructure as a cornerstone for digital transformation.
